Russian national accused of developing, selling malware appears in U.S. court
Feb. 23, 2023, 6:20 p.m. | AJ Vicens
CyberScoop www.cyberscoop.com
Dariy Pankov faces up to 47 years in prison on charges linked to credential sales and offering access to the NLBrute malware.
